The film was a critical success, winning the NETPAC Award at the 2014 Toronto International Film Festival for its universal and groundbreaking portrayal of a world defined by "love for life". The movie received critical acclaim upon its release, with many praising Kalki Koechlin's performance and the film's sensitive and thoughtful storytelling. "Margarita with a Straw" won several awards, including the Best Film and Best Actress awards at the 2015 Ooty International Film Festival.

"Margarita with a Straw" is a powerful and emotional drama that will resonate with audiences long after the credits roll. The movie features outstanding performances from its lead actors, particularly Kalki Koechlin, who brings depth and nuance to her portrayal of Laila.
